Anti proliferative Potential of Ergosterol : A Unique Plant Sterol on Hep2 Cell Line

Journal Title: International Journal of Pharma Research and Health Sciences - Year 2017, Vol 5, Issue 4

Abstract

The anti proliferative effect of ergosterol (5,7, 22-ergostatrien-3b-ol) was studied, it is a type of plant sterol ,which are present in two main forms, free and esterifies. MTT assay showed that the ergosterol had marked cytotoxic activity in Hep2 cancer cells. We observed the higher concentrations (40, 80,160 and 320 μM/mL) of ergosterol treatment significantly showed increased cytotoxicity in Hep2 cells. The IC50 value was found to be 40 μM/mL of ergosterol could greatly inhibit the cell growth. So, we have chosen at 40 and 320 μM/mL concentration of ergosterol for further experiments. We observed increased levels of Lipid peroxidation and decreased levels of anti oxidants (SOD, CAT, GPx, and GSH) in Hep2 cell line, because of the pro oxidant mechanism of ergosterol. Present results showed that the treatment of Hep2 cells with 320 μM/mL of ergosterol significantly increased levels of TBARS and decreased enzymatic and non enzymatic levels when compared to other doses. These observations revealed the cytotoxic potential of ergosterol, which could be attributed to their pro-oxidant property on the Hep2 cells. It is evident from the observation made in the present study that the ergosterol has potential anticancer effect.
